The > > lock isn't needed since each plane's register are neatly > > contained on their own cachelines. > > > > The locking did have a secondary effect of disabling > > interrupts around the cursor registers writes though. > > If we drop that then we open outselves up for sceduling > > delays and whatnot while on the middle of the register > > writes. That increases the chance of not all the register > > writes land during the same frame. For normal atomic > > commits this is not a concern as the vblank evade mechanism > > anyway disables interrupts around the update, but the legacy > > cursor codepath does not. Technically we should do a vblank > > evade there as well, but so far no one has bothered to hook > > that up. So in the meantime let's put an explicit local irq > > disable/enable around the legacy cursor update to keep the > > race window minimal. > > > > v2: local_irq_{disable,enable}() for legacy cursor ioctl > > Guess, this will help our infamous atomic update evasion time exceeeded. > I think I've even checked with similar patch. > Good that its finally will make its way into kernel.
